Biography of Bill Belichick

Bill Belichick was born on April 16, 1952, in Nashville, Tennessee, into a family deeply rooted in football. His father, Steve Belichick, was a longtime assistant coach and scout at the United States Naval Academy, which exposed young Bill to the intricacies of the game from an early age. Growing up in Annapolis, Maryland, Belichick developed a passion for football and began honing his skills both on and off the field. After graduating from Wesleyan University in 1975, where he played football and lacrosse, Belichick embarked on a coaching career that would eventually redefine the sport.

Belichick’s professional journey began with the Baltimore Colts in 1975, where he worked as a special teams coach under legendary head coach Ted Marchibroda. His meticulous approach to the game quickly earned him recognition, and he soon moved on to roles with the Detroit Lions, Denver Broncos, and New York Giants. It was during his tenure with the Giants that Belichick established himself as a defensive mastermind, helping the team secure two Super Bowl victories in the 1980s. His reputation as a strategic genius paved the way for his eventual rise to head coaching positions, including his iconic role with the New England Patriots.
